CELEBRATION: Friar Phage Hunters Present their Research at the 3rd Annual Celebration of Student Scholarship and Creativity

On April 25, 2012, the Friar Phage Hunters headed off to present our phage posters at Providence College’s Third Annual Celebration of Student Scholarship & Creativity which was held in Slavin Center.  I think it’s safe to say that we definitely made quite an impression wearing our new orange SEA ReSEArch shirts from HHMI.

During the two hour event, all of us got a chance to present our posters, to eat to our hearts content, and to learn about the scholarship of other PC students working at the college.  Research that science students had participated in ranged from studying the nerve systems of squids and Alzheimer’s disease to developing eco-friendly toilets.  The creative work of many art students was also shown at the event.  Father Shanley, president of Providence College, even stopped by to talk to Stephen about his poster!  Good food and classy shirts. Who could ask for a better poster session?
